WebDerek Walcott (1930-2024), a Caribbean poet and playwright who won the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1992, published his first collection of poetry at the age of fourteen that is full … WebIn “Ruins of a Great House,” Derek Walcott quotes twice from John Donne’s poem “No Man is an Island.” Donne’s poem argues that no one can afford to worry only about themself, because we are all connected to and dependent on one another.
